Ease your Menstrual Cramps

Menstrual cramps are scientifically known as Dysmenorrhea. Severity of these cramps usually vary from one woman to another. The pain usually  occur in the lower abdominal and pelvic areas as a result of these cramps. Sometimes the pain can be felt in the thighs and lower back too. Popping up a pill is not recommended as it as many side effects. It is always good to ease the pain with natural home remedies,which has no side effects.These are few home remedies which can be followed to ease menstrual cramps.

  • Increase your liquid consumption  to prevent dehydration as dehydration aggravates menstrual cramps.
  • Place a hot water bag on the stomach to ease the stomach cramps.
  • Ginger is a wonderful  herb that has tremendous health benefits. Boil some ginger pieces in water and sip it through out the day.
  • Drinking more hot liquids promotes blood flow to the pelvic area and helps relaxing pelvic muscles. Consuming green tea and herbal teas  helps in relieving stomach cramp. 
  • Women whose bodies are weak, tends to suffer menstrual cramps in greater severity. It is advisable to pop up some vitamin pills to ease the menstrual pain.
